Understanding and troubleshooting formula reference errors in Excel can be a daunting task, even for the most seasoned users. However, with the right approach and knowledge, you can tackle these errors confidently and keep your spreadsheets running smoothly. Whether you're working on financial models, data analysis, or simple lists, learning to manage these errors is essential. In this guide, we’ll explore common reference errors, helpful tips, advanced techniques, and how to troubleshoot issues, ensuring you become an Excel pro! 🏆
Common Excel Reference Errors
Before diving into the troubleshooting techniques, it’s vital to understand the types of reference errors you may encounter in Excel:
-
#REF! Error: This occurs when a formula refers to a cell that is not valid. Often, this happens if you delete a cell that was referenced in a formula.
-
#VALUE! Error: This error typically indicates that the wrong type of argument or operand is being used in the formula. For example, using text in a mathematical operation can lead to this error.
-
#NAME? Error: This happens when Excel doesn’t recognize a name that’s used in a formula. This could be due to misspelling a function name or failing to define a named range.
-
#DIV/0! Error: You’ll see this error when a number is divided by zero or an empty cell. It’s a reminder that division cannot occur with a denominator of zero.
-
#N/A Error: This error signifies that a value is not available to a function or formula. It often appears in functions like VLOOKUP when it cannot find a lookup value.
Troubleshooting Common Reference Errors
When dealing with these errors, you can take several steps to identify and fix the problem:
Step 1: Review Your Formula
Carefully check the formula for any obvious mistakes. Look for:
- Incorrect references: Ensure that all cell references are accurate.
- Typographical errors: Double-check for typos in function names.
- Valid ranges: Make sure that the ranges defined in the formulas exist and are properly defined.
Step 2: Use the Formula Auditing Tools
Excel offers some useful built-in auditing tools:
- Trace Precedents: This feature lets you see which cells are directly referenced by the formula. You can access it under the "Formulas" tab and click "Trace Precedents."
- Trace Dependents: This tool allows you to see which cells depend on the selected cell. This helps identify where a formula might be broken.
- Evaluate Formula: By using this option, you can step through your formula and see how Excel evaluates it, which can clarify where things are going wrong.
Step 3: Handle Errors Gracefully
Incorporate error-handling functions in your formulas:
- IFERROR function: You can use this function to return a custom message when an error occurs. For example:
=IFERROR(A1/B1, "Division by zero")
- ISERROR function: This can help check if a formula results in an error, allowing for alternate calculations or messages.
Step 4: Check for Circular References
A circular reference occurs when a formula refers back to its own cell. To check for this, navigate to the “Formulas” tab and look for circular reference warnings. Resolve these by adjusting the formula to prevent it from looping back on itself.
Step 5: Confirm Data Types
Ensure that the data types used in your formulas are compatible. For instance, if your formula involves text, ensure the cells involved actually contain text. Mismatched types can cause #VALUE! errors.
Helpful Tips and Shortcuts
-
Use Named Ranges: Instead of using cell references, utilize named ranges for clarity and ease of management. They make formulas easier to read and reduce the likelihood of errors.
-
Keyboard Shortcuts: Familiarize yourself with shortcuts to improve efficiency, such as
F2
to edit a formula directly in the cell. -
Break Down Complex Formulas: If you have lengthy formulas, break them down into smaller parts using helper columns. This can simplify troubleshooting and help you pinpoint issues.
Common Mistakes to Avoid
-
Neglecting to Update Ranges: When adding or deleting rows/columns, remember to adjust any formulas that reference those changes.
-
Inconsistent Data Entry: Ensure that data is entered consistently (e.g., not mixing text and numbers) to prevent reference errors.
-
Ignoring Error Alerts: Pay attention to Excel's error alerts and notifications. They can provide valuable insights into what’s going wrong.
Advanced Techniques for Excel Reference Errors
Once you’ve mastered the basics, consider these advanced techniques to handle reference errors even better:
-
Array Formulas: Learn to use array formulas for more complex calculations that might normally cause reference errors.
-
Dynamic Ranges with OFFSET: By combining OFFSET with COUNTA or COUNTIF, you can create dynamic ranges that adjust automatically based on your data.
-
Using INDIRECT Function: The INDIRECT function can create dynamic references that can help avoid reference errors when rows or columns are changed.
Practical Examples
-
Simple Division Formula: If you want to calculate sales per employee but some cells are empty:
=IFERROR(A1/B1, 0)
This avoids the #DIV/0! error by returning 0 if the denominator is empty.
-
Using Named Ranges: Instead of:
=SUM(A1:A10)
You can name the range "SalesData" and use:
=SUM(SalesData)
-
Error Handling in VLOOKUP: If you are searching for a value that might not exist:
=IFERROR(VLOOKUP(A1, B:C, 2, FALSE), "Not Found")
<div class="faq-section"> <div class="faq-container"> <h2>Frequently Asked Questions</h2> <div class="faq-item"> <div class="faq-question"> <h3>What is the main cause of the #REF! error?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>The #REF! error occurs when a cell reference in a formula is not valid, typically due to deleting a cell that was referenced.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>How can I fix the #DIV/0! error?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Use the IFERROR function to handle this error gracefully, or check the denominator to ensure it is not zero or blank.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>What does the #NAME? error indicate?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>This error indicates that Excel does not recognize the name or function used in your formula. Check for typos or unrecognized names.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>Can I prevent errors from showing up in my formulas?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Yes, use error handling functions like IFERROR or ISERROR to provide alternative results instead of showing the error.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>How do I check for circular references?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Go to the Formulas tab and look for the Circular References option to identify any formulas that refer back to themselves.</p> </div> </div> </div> </div>
In conclusion, mastering Excel formula reference errors is essential for smooth and efficient spreadsheet management. By understanding the types of errors, applying troubleshooting techniques, and using helpful tips, you’ll feel empowered to tackle any issue that arises. Keep practicing your Excel skills and explore related tutorials to further enhance your expertise!
<p class="pro-note">💡Pro Tip: Regularly audit your spreadsheets to catch and fix reference errors before they become problems!</p>